Boric Acid - very high purity at 99.9% Boric acid, also known as Orthoboric Acid, Boracic acid, Trihydroxidoboron.
Weak acid, completely soluble in water.
Boric Acid has many uses, from use as a trace element fertilisers and hydroponic nutrients to fungicide, home made antkiller and cockroach killer ( for recipes), hide and skin preservation, antiseptics, flame retardant to chemical synthesis,
Boric Acid is also used as a fireproofing agent for wood, as a preservative, and as an antiseptic. Boric acid is used in the manufacture of glass, pottery, enamels, glazes, cosmetics, cements, porcelain, leather, carpets, hats, soaps, artificial gems, and in printing, dyeing, painting, and photography.
Formula: H3BO3
Molar mass: 61.83 g/mol
Melting point: 170.9 °C
Density: 1.44 g/cm³
